What is Natural Horsemanship?

Natural Horsemanship, sometimes referred to as “gentle” horsemanship, is a psychology-based training philosophy that considers the animal’s natural instincts in order to gain the horse’s trust, submission, and cooperation.  Horses are prey animals, whereas humans are technically predators.
